With the above Mission Statement at the forefront of what we do, the Human Resources Office is responsible for the maintenance of personnel records for the diocesan central offices, oversees the administration of employee benefits and maintains payroll information for the central office staff. We also provide human resource services for all the schools and parishes in the diocese and is responsible for job descriptions, performance appraisals, salary ranges, salary surveys and human resource training for the diocese.
The office is also available to assist schools and parishes with questions related to employment and benefits for any staff member.

If you are working through a temp agency or have had a fingerprint report done through another employer you will need the Authorization For Release of Records and Reports form below. This authorizes the former entity to release your records to the diocese. If they comply, you will not have to have the report done at this time.

Additional Requirements for School Employees
State law requires all schools (both non-public and public) to conduct an Unprofessional Conduct check on all newly employed teachers with their current or former employers. The employee will be required to sign the Consent for Release of Information Form which will be kept on file at the school. The Information Request Form will then be forwarded to the current or former employer for their completion.
